William Jennings Bryan, of Lincoln, Nebraska, editor of the Commoner, and three times the Democratic candidate for the Presidency, will speak on "Public Speaking and Politics" in New Lecture Hall, tomorrow afternoon, at 3.40 o'clock. The lecture, which is being given under the auspices of the Speakers' Club, will be open to members of the University.
